Hypercore Protocol
Development
Hypercore Protocol is a secure, distributed append-only log built on top of Hypercore, which is a secure peer-to-peer datastore. It allows for decentralized apps and filesystems to be built using append-only logs as their storage mechanism.

Microsoft PowerPoint
Office & Productivity
Microsoft PowerPoint is a popular presentation software developed by Microsoft. It allows users to create professional slides with text, images, charts, animations, and more. PowerPoint presentations can be shared and presented easily.
